Farmer ‘eaten by his pigs’

A FARMER in the US has apparently been eaten by his pigs.

Terry Garner, 70, did not return after he set out to feed his animals on his farm near the Oregon coast.

A family member later found his dentures and pieces of his body in the pigsty, but most of his remains had been consumed.

The district attorney’s office said it was possible Mr Garner had a heart attack, or was knocked over by the animals before he was killed. But criminal activity has not been ruled out.

Police said the pigs – which weigh up to 50 stones – had been aggressive with or had bitten Mr Garner previously.
